An impressive Grade II listed 17th century manor house with four residential cottages set in its own private valley within 75 acres of land which includes an ancient woodland, 6 acres of landscaped gardens and salmon fishing. A fifth cottage is for sale as a separate Lot.

Talhenbont Hall offers an extremely rare opportunity to acquire what must be one of the most imposing private houses on the Lleyn Peninsula. The hall has been sympathetically restored by the current owners over the last 30 years. There are some handsome original oak panelled rooms, superb fireplaces and a coat of arms. It offers a comfortable, manageable centrally heated system and mainly leaded light double glazed accommodation. The Manor House offers well proportioned rooms from which you have beautiful views across the gardens and grounds.
There are four adjoining self catering cottages which retain a wealth of character features, such as exposed stone walls, timber beams and are offered as a going concern for weekly holiday lets. Accounts are available to bona fide parties interested in purchasing.
A fifth self catering cottage, The Lodge, is available for sale as a separate Lot.
The gardens and grounds are a particular feature of the property which include a Japanese water garden, water fowl, roaming peacocks, outdoor chess, putting green and a tennis court. The Afon Dwyfach (Dwyfach River) flows for a mile and a half which provides double bank fishing and runs over a series of waterfalls in a ravine through the ancient woodlands. It is a designated habitat for otters. There are deep and shallow pools which harbour salmon and sea trout throughout the season. There is rough shooting throughout the woodlands.
